Our Take

The Pride Mobility Quest is a light, modern pavement scooter. It weighs 26 kg with its battery fitted, and folds down for storage and transport. The battery lifts out on a key release and weighs 3 kg, so the piece you actually carry is 23.1 kg. That makes it easy to keep in a hallway and to take in the car. Top speed is 4 mph, and it covers around 10 miles on a charge. It carries riders up to 115 kg. The controls are simple, and a tight turning circle helps in shops and narrow aisles. A front basket handles the shopping. If you want a smart, easy-to-handle scooter for local trips, the Quest fits well.

For all its convenience, the Quest keeps things simple. The range runs to about 10 miles, so it is a local runabout, not a long-haul scooter. It is Class 2 and pavement-only, so it stays off the road. Ground clearance is modest at 7.6 cm, so it prefers smooth, flat surfaces to kerbs and rough paths. And 23.1 kg is still a real lift — worth checking you can manage it before you rely on it. So it is the wrong choice if you need real range or all-terrain grip. But as a stylish, foldable scooter for everyday trips, it does its job nicely.

Buyers looking at the Pride Mobility Quest usually want something that goes in the car without a fuss — and it isn’t the only option there. The Freerider Mini Ranger dismantles for the boot and the Motion Healthcare Alumina is heavier at 31.8kg, while the Motion Healthcare Evolite breaks into parts from about 10kg.

The Basics

Scooter Class
Class 2/Pavement Only
Brand
Pride
Number of Wheels
4
Pavement Use
Yes
Road Use
No
Max Speed mph
4 mph
Max Range (Approx.)
10 miles
Total weight — with battery
26 kg
Total weight — without battery
23.1 kg
Battery weight
3 kg
Battery removable
Yes — key-release pack, no tools
Heaviest Part
23.1 kg
Heaviest part comprises
The folded scooter, battery removed
User Weight Capacity
115 kg
Folding
Yes
Dismantles (Car Boot Scooter)
No

Key Specifications

Battery
24V Li-ion 11.5Ah, removable (on/off-board)
Charging Time
5-6 (lithium)
Tyre Type
Solid (7.8" front, 9" rear)
Seat Type
Folding moulded seat 16", no armrests
